One of the most significant benefits of gardening is its positive impact on mental health. Gardening has been shown to reduce symptoms of anxiety and depression while promoting feelings of relaxation and well-being. It allows individuals to unplug from the stresses of modern life and focus on the present moment, connecting with nature and the natural rhythms of the world. Additionally, gardening provides a sense of accomplishment and pride as plants grow and thrive.

Physical health benefits are also a significant factor in gardening. It provides exercise in the form of digging, planting, and weeding, which can improve strength and flexibility. Additionally, gardening allows individuals to grow their fruits and vegetables, providing a source of fresh and nutritious food. By growing their produce, gardeners can reduce their grocery bills and ensure that the food they consume is free of harmful chemicals and pesticides.

Gardening also has a positive impact on the environment. Plants absorb carbon dioxide from the atmosphere, reducing the levels of this greenhouse gas that contribute to the negative effects of global warming. Additionally, gardens provide habitats for insects and birds, supporting biodiversity in local ecosystems.

If you are interested in starting a garden, there are a few tips to keep in mind. First, pick the right location. Most plants need at least six hours of sunlight per day, so choose an area that receives enough direct sunlight. Additionally, consider the soil quality, drainage, and accessibility when deciding where to plant.

Next, choose the right plants for your garden. Look for plants that are well-suited to your climate, soil, and level of experience. Consider starting with easy-to-grow varieties such as tomatoes or cucumbers. Additionally, select plants that provide benefits such as attracting pollinators or providing edible fruit.

Maintaining a garden requires regular upkeep. Water plants regularly, following the specific needs of each variety. Keep an eye out for pests and disease, and take steps to prevent or address any issues. Additionally, weed regularly to reduce competition for resources like water and nutrients.

Finally, remember to enjoy the process. Gardening can be a relaxing and rewarding hobby, but it can also be frustrating at times. Accept that mistakes will be made, and not every plant will thrive. Focus on the positive aspects of gardening, such as enjoying the beauty of plants or the taste of fresh produce.
